The Philadelphia Fashion Incubator offers fashion entrepreneurs retail space to sell their collections along with comprehensive curriculum-based workshops focusing on the core components of how to launch their brands and sustain their businesses in the ever changing global fashion marketplace. The workshops will include sessions ranging from digital marketing, retail pricing and cost/value analysis, to distribution channels and finance management. Designers will also learn about profit margins, markups, sourcing and production. After undergoing this curriculum, the designers will have the essential business tools to maintain, manage and grow a successful fashion company.

Eligibility

Applicants seeking admission to the Philadelphia Fashion Incubator are required to:

  • Reside in the Philadelphia Region or surrounding areas, including Southern New Jersey and Delaware.

  • Be 21 years of age or older.

  • Provide a minimum of five (5) images of your product. Ideally work that best reflects your vision for your brand.  If called back for an interview, plan to show these samples but preferably more.

  • Have already started a business (6 months-5 years)

  • Serious commitment to further sustain and scale your business.

  • Be able to commit to PFI and their businesses completely, utilizing all available resources.

  • Residency Tuition $400/month for the 12-24 months. Full Tuition Grants are available through the partnering organization(s).

Ineligibility

Designers who are ineligible to apply to this program:

  • Students currently enrolled in a college or university, trade program, or other accredited educational institution.

  • Those who cannot attend the full curriculum of workshops. Minimum one workshop a week.

Judging Criteria

The Philadelphia Fashion Incubator Selection Committee, comprised of a team of industry professionals, will review applications based on the below criteria. Designers-in-Residence should:

  • Have the ability to commit to the program completely, utilizing all available resources, with the intent to launch their businesses as a full-time career.

  • Have a strong vision for their collection and/or a great business concept.

  • Demonstrate the highest level of responsibility and dedication to both the program and their business.

  • Demonstrate a manageable level of financial ability to fund their new businesses ($15,000+).

  • Have the ability to work well with others with the desire and flexibility to engage in and be respectful of the program’s many collaborations.

  • Understand that while we are here to provide resources and help our Designers-In-Residence establish their businesses, ultimately, our designers are responsible for each and every aspect of beginning, operating, and growing their individual companies.

  • Understand that we cannot help teach design. We do our best to provide the resources to help lay a proper business and production foundation for our designers.
